Brian Meredith work experience

A career timeline built from the work history available for this profile.

Research Associate Ii

San Diego, Ca, Us

o Primary contributor in the validation and optimization of the Bionex Dual-Hive automation system for execution of Vividion's proteomic sample prep assay. Created an alternate workflow for troubleshooting the validation of the system by utilizing protein and peptide quantification assays instead of MS analysis to increase throughput of troubleshooting period by 300%.o Developed, optimized, and validated an automated ELISA protocol for application in weekly compound profiling for a lead target. Enabled scientists to increase throughput by 6 hours per week. o Developed, optimized, and validated a VWorks form and 9 protocols to enable fully automated compound plate production for the Platform & Proteomics group. Scripted with JavaScript to allow for combinations of inputs to be captured and used to drive the generation of a runset to produce plates in any desired plate format and dilution scheme. Projected to save 10 FTE hours per week.o Inclusive of all responsibilities as Research Associate I at Vividion Therapeutics.

Feb 2019 - Nov 2019

Research Associate I

San Diego, Ca, Us

o Execution of Vividion’s proprietary proteomic sample prep assay on a weekly basis to generate MS data enabling the assessment of compound target engagement proteome-wide for new screens and lead evaluation studies. Involved upstream workflow of converting study requests into associated mass-spec experiment ID(s), compound plates, and tracking of experiment progress through the 3-4 day sample prep protocol.o Led Vividion’s design, implementation, and validation of the Bionex Dual-Hive automation system. Involved concept design of a custom dispenser coupled with a vacuum filtration manifold to reduce plate-handling time by 60% for filtration steps during automated runs. Mitigated project challenges involving global supplier shortages and fluid timelines impacting finance decisions over the course of a year.o Developed, optimized, and validated Bravo protocols for all use cases within the Platform & Proteomics group and Biology department, enabling rapid execution of various compound dilution schemes, ELISA(s), and plate reformatting. Protocols were scripted with JavaScript to provide maximum end-user flexibility and ease of use through variable capture and decision trees.o Primary contributor in the management and execution of Vividion’s compound library stamp into mother plates and assay-ready compound plates for use in the proteomic sample prep assay for screening. Developed, optimized, and validated all Bravo protocols and liquid classes used in this process. o Trained end-users to transition assay development and production assays from manual execution to semi- or fully-automated execution to increase throughput and reliability of assay execution. Involved protocol development and validation on platforms like the Agilent Bravo, Formulatrix Mantis, BioTek EL 406, and Bionex Dual-Hive automation system.
